Cost of Living Calculator - Oklahoma City, Oklahoma vs Cedar Grove, New Jersey


The cost of living in Cedar Grove, New Jersey is 67.4% more expensive than Oklahoma City, Oklahoma.

You would need a salary of $83,709 in Cedar Grove, New Jersey to maintain the standard of living you have in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Cedar Grove, New Jersey is more expensive than Oklahoma City, Oklahoma
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
197% more expensive in Cedar Grove
than in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ma
